I’ve installed OggSync for Outlook, but I don’t see it anywhere?

0

OggSync version 4 runs in the system tray and appears as a red circle. If it is not there, start it in the start menu ~ OggSync. To access the features RIGHT click the red circle in the system tray to bring up the menu. Q) I’m getting: Error: Retrieving the COM class factory for component with CLSID {620D55B0-F2FB-464E-A278-B4308DB1DB2B} failed due to the following error: 80040154. A) It looks like one of the DLL’s didn’t get registered for some reason. Please give this a try: regsvr32 “C:\program files\icoa inc\OggSync Desktop v4\Redemption.dll” Q) I’m getting: Error: “Retrieving the COM class factory for component with CLSID {0006F03A-0000-0000-C000-000000000046} failed due to the following error: 80040154 Class not registered (Exception from HRESULT: 0×80040154 (REGDB_E_CLASSNOTREG)).” That error means your interop libraries are not installed. 1) Try uninstalling and re-installing OggSync. If that doesn’t work go to step 2. 2) Try installing: http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/
